site stats

Improve time complexity of algorithm

Witryna13 kwi 2024 · This new reality of how information is catered and served by algorithms on social media and web feeds for individuals and how they consult different sources … Witryna4.3. Time Complexity Analysis. The computing effort required to run an algorithm is referred to as its time complexity. Suppose is the overall scale, is the dimension, is the maximum number of iterations, and is the time necessary to solve the objective function.. It can be seen from the literature [38, 39] that the SSA algorithm’s time complexity is

8 time complexities that every programmer should …

Witryna7 lis 2024 · An algorithm is said to have a logarithmic time complexity when it reduces the size of the input data in each step. This indicates that the number of operations is … Witryna28 maj 2024 · Summary. Time complexity describes how the runtime of an algorithm changes depending on the amount of input data. The most common complexity classes are (in ascending order of complexity): O (1), O (log n), O (n), O (n log n), O (n²). Algorithms with constant, logarithmic, linear, and quasilinear time usually lead to an … some card readers https://lamontjaxon.com

Algorithms Free Full-Text LSTM Accelerator for Convolutional …

Witryna7 lis 2024 · An algorithm is said to have a non-linear time complexity where the running time increases non-linearly (n^2) with the length of the input. Generally, nested loops come under this order where one loop takes O (n) and if the function involves a loop within a loop, then it goes for O (n)*O (n) = O (n^2) order. Witryna26 sie 2024 · Time complexity is a programming term that quantifies the amount of time it takes a sequence of code or an algorithm to process or execute in proportion to the size and cost of input. It will not look at an algorithm's overall execution time. Rather, it will provide data on the variation (increase or reduction) in execution time when the … Witryna10 sty 2024 · Best Time Complexity: Define the input for which algorithm takes less time or minimum ... some came running the movie

Algorithmic Complexity - Devopedia

Category:The Big-O! Time complexity with examples - Medium

Tags:Improve time complexity of algorithm

Improve time complexity of algorithm

Time Complexity: How to measure the efficiency of algorithms

WitrynaAn important consideration is time complexity, which is the rate at which the time required to find a solution increases with the number of parameters (weights). In short, the time complexities of a range of different gradient-based methods (including second-order methods) seem to be similar. WitrynaThe asymptotic time complexity of the algorithm T [n] ... At the same time, the SEACO algorithm can better accelerate the optimization speed in the early stage of the traditional ACO algorithm and is more applicable to approximate large-scale TSP with limited time window, which can provide a promising direction to improve searching …

Improve time complexity of algorithm

Did you know?

Witryna25 lis 2024 · Analysis of Time Complexity We can analyze the time complexity of F(n) by counting the number of times its most expensive operation will execute for n number of inputs. For this algorithm, the operation contributing the greatest runtime cost is addition. 4.1. Finding an Equation for Time Complexity Witryna17 lut 2024 · Improvements V and VI are proposed to replace Improvements I and II to replace the existing recursive V-BLAST algorithms, and speed up the existing algorithm with speed advantage by the factor of 1.3. Improvements I-IV were proposed to reduce the computational complexity of the original recursive algorithm for vertical Bell …

WitrynaParallel algorithms are designed to improve the computation speed of a computer. For analyzing a Parallel Algorithm, we normally consider the following parameters − ... Total cost of a parallel algorithm is the product of time complexity and the number of processors used in that particular algorithm. WitrynaIn computer science, the time complexity is the computational complexity that describes the amount of computer time it takes to run an algorithm. Time …

Witryna14 lip 2024 · Image by author. Best Case: It defines as the condition that allows an algorithm to complete the execution of statements in the minimum amount of time. In this case, the execution time acts as a lower bound on the algorithm’s time complexity. Average Case: In the average case, we get the sum of running times on every … Witryna5 kwi 2024 · This work builds upon the improper learning algorithm of Bshouty and Tamon (JACM '96) and the proper semiagnostic learning algorithm of Lange, Rubinfeld, and Vasilyan (FOCS '22), which obtains a non-monotone Boolean-valued hypothesis, then ``corrects'' it to monotone using query-efficient local computation algorithms on …

Witryna6 lut 2011 · Time complexity is a complete theoretical concept related to algorithms, while running time is the time a code would take to run, not at all theoretical. Two algorithms may have the same time complexity, say O (n^2), but one may take twice as much running time as the other one. Share Improve this answer Follow answered …

Witryna10 kwi 2024 · Microstrip patch smart antenna is modelled for millimetre wave frequency application to improve the performance of antenna in terms of gain and bandwidth. In … some card gamesWitryna10 cze 2024 · The algorithm that performs the task in the smallest number of operations is considered the most efficient one in terms of the time complexity. However, the space and time complexity are also affected by factors such as your operating system and hardware, but we are not including them in this discussion. some can read war and peaceWitryna22 mar 2024 · An algorithm will have a linear time complexity when the running time will increase linearly concerning the given input’s length. When the function checks all the values within input data, such type of function has … some card games and how to playWitryna19 lut 2024 · While complexity is usually in terms of time, sometimes complexity is also analyzed in terms of space, which translates to the algorithm's memory … some carmelites crosswordWitryna10 kwi 2024 · Traffic sign detection is an important part of environment-aware technology and has great potential in the field of intelligent transportation. In recent years, deep learning has been widely used in the field of traffic sign detection, achieving excellent performance. Due to the complex traffic environment, recognizing and detecting … small business live chat softwareWitryna30 sty 2024 · Time complexity is very useful measure in algorithm analysis. It is the time needed for the completion of an algorithm. To estimate the time complexity, … some cars are trucks all trucks are scootersWitryna9 kwi 2024 · 1 Answer. This is of O (n^2). You can easily calculate the time complexity of your solution which is basically the brute-force way of doing this problem. In the worst case, you have a Sum of [n, n-1,..., 1] which is equal to n * (n + 1) /2 which is of O (n^2). Note that such platforms cannot really calculate the time complexity, they just set a ... small business llc liability insurance